    The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) is seeking information from potential contractors for Medical Gas Delivery services at the Greater Los Angeles Healthcare System, specifically for the West Los Angeles VA Medical Center. The procurement aims to identify qualified Service-Disabled Veteran Owned Small Businesses (SDVOSB), Veteran Owned Small Businesses (VOSB), and other small businesses capable of supplying various medical gases, including Liquid Nitrogen, Argon Gas, Compressed Air, Carbon Dioxide, and Oxygen, all of which must meet stringent FDA and DOT regulations. Interested parties are required to submit their company details, including their SAM UEI number, contact information, business type, and socioeconomic status by December 29, 2025, to the Contracting Officer, Ms. Renee Kale, at renee.kale@va.gov. This sources sought notice is for planning purposes only and does not solicit quotes at this time.

    The VA Greater Los Angeles Medical Center Department of Medical Research at the West Los Angeles (WLA) and Sepulveda (SEP) Campuses requires a contract for medical cylinder gases, including Liquid Nitrogen, Argon Gas, Compressed Air, Carbon Dioxide, Oxygen, and Custom Liquid Gas Mixes. All gases must conform to USP and National Formulary specifications, and manufacturers/fillers must be FDA registered and comply with CGMP regulations (21 CFR Parts 210, 211, and 201). Contractors must provide annual verification of current FDA and state licenses/certifications/registrations, or reseller agreements if not the manufacturer. Deliveries are recurring and automatic, primarily to research labs between 8:00 am and 4:30 pm, with old tanks swapped out. Emergency orders must be filled within 24 hours. Cylinders must comply with DOT specifications, be maintained, filled, marked, labeled, and shipped according to current DOT regulations (49 CFR), Federal Food, Drug, and Cosmetic Act, and CGA publications for marking, color coding, and valves. The contractor is responsible for all maintenance and testing of contractor-owned cylinders. Pricing for gas includes all services required for cylinder filling and compliance.
